Years ago, I was at a meditation workshop when she entered.
Dressed in a flowing white robe. A crystal in the center of her forehead. An honest-to-god attendant scampering behind her.
Whoa.
It was definitely hard not to notice her.
For most of the workshop, she made it clear that she wanted the rest of us to know how awakened she was.
But was she really? (Spoiler alert—um, that’s a big ‘ol NO!)
So many people get caught in a version of what I call pseudo-awakening. The state of wanting to appear to be awake and acknowledged as such. But the sad thing is that it couldn’t be further from the true awakening that people yearn for.
In this episode, we discuss what pseudo-awakening is, how it can sneak up on us, and why it actually ironically pushes us even further away from spiritual awakening.

SUMMARY:
There’s a whole genre of ineffective spirituality—whether it’s love and light, wearing white and saying mantras, hoping something will change, or even just saying affirmations and desperately hoping for something to happen. All of this falls into a distorted version of awakening, that I call pseudo-awakening.
Pseudo-awakening is problematic and counter-productive because it only feeds the ego/mind’s need for importance, to be seen as “better than” in a certain way, which ironically pulls you further from the awakening that you wished you had.
